> ## Documentation Index
> Fetch the complete documentation index at: https://mintlify-docs-automation-github-pr-review.mintlify.site/llms.txt
> Use this file to discover all available pages before exploring further.

# SEO et recherche

> Configurez le SEO dans docs.json : description du site, indexation par les moteurs de recherche, balises meta, placeholder de barre de recherche et horodatages.

Utilisez ces paramètres dans votre fichier `docs.json` pour contrôler comment les moteurs de recherche indexent votre documentation, quelles métadonnées apparaissent dans les résultats de recherche, comment la barre de recherche se comporte et si les pages affichent un horodatage de dernière modification.

## Paramètres

### `description`

**Type :** `string`

Une description de votre site de documentation pour le SEO et l'indexation par l'IA. Elle apparaît dans les résultats des moteurs de recherche et les outils d'IA l'utilisent pour comprendre l'objectif de votre site.

```json docs.json theme={null}
"description": "Documentation pour l'API et la plateforme développeur d'Example Co."
```

***

### `seo`

**Type :** `object`

Paramètres d'indexation et de métadonnées pour les moteurs de recherche.

<ResponseField name="seo.indexing" type="&#x22;navigable&#x22; | &#x22;all&#x22;">
  Spécifie quelles pages les moteurs de recherche doivent indexer.

  * `navigable` — Indexer uniquement les pages incluses dans la navigation de votre `docs.json`. C'est la valeur par défaut.
  * `all` — Indexer toutes les pages de votre projet, y compris les pages qui ne sont pas dans la navigation.
</ResponseField>

<ResponseField name="seo.metatags" type="object">
  Balises meta personnalisées ajoutées à chaque page. Fournies sous forme de paires clé-valeur où chaque clé est un nom de balise meta et la valeur est son contenu.

  Voir [référence des balises meta courantes](/fr/optimize/seo#common-meta-tags-reference) pour les options disponibles.

  ```json theme={null}
  "metatags": {
    "og:site_name": "Example Co. Docs",
    "twitter:card": "summary_large_image"
  }
  ```
</ResponseField>

```json docs.json theme={null}
"seo": {
  "indexing": "navigable",
  "metatags": {
    "og:site_name": "Example Co. Docs"
  }
}
```

***

### `search`

**Type :** `object`

Paramètres d'affichage de la barre de recherche.

<ResponseField name="search.prompt" type="string">
  Texte d'espace réservé affiché dans la barre de recherche lorsqu'elle est vide.
</ResponseField>

```json docs.json theme={null}
"search": {
  "prompt": "Rechercher dans la documentation..."
}
```

***

### `metadata`

**Type :** `object`

Paramètres de métadonnées au niveau de la page appliqués globalement à toutes les pages.

<ResponseField name="metadata.timestamp" type="boolean">
  Affiche une date de dernière modification sur toutes les pages. Lorsqu'elle est activée, chaque page affiche la date de la dernière modification de son contenu. Valeur par défaut : `false`.

  Vous pouvez remplacer ce paramètre pour des pages individuelles en utilisant le champ frontmatter `timestamp`. Voir [Pages](/fr/organize/pages#last-modified-timestamp) pour plus de détails.
</ResponseField>

```json docs.json theme={null}
"metadata": {
  "timestamp": true
}
```

## Exemple

```json docs.json theme={null}
{
  "description": "Documentation pour l'API et la plateforme développeur d'Example Co.",
  "seo": {
    "indexing": "navigable",
    "metatags": {
      "og:site_name": "Example Co. Docs",
      "twitter:card": "summary_large_image"
    }
  },
  "search": {
    "prompt": "Rechercher dans la documentation..."
  },
  "metadata": {
    "timestamp": true
  }
}
```
